Operating System (OS) Definition and Examples

Definition: An operating system is a collection of programs that control the application software that users run and provides an link between the hardware and software currently running on the computer. The operating system is also responsible for the management and control of all resources (memory, hard drives, monitor, etc.) that are shared amongst the different application programs that may be running simultaneously.
